What is Organic Vermicompost?

Organic vermicompost is a natural soil amendment created through the decomposition of organic materials by earthworms. During this process, earthworms consume organic matter and transform it into nutrient-rich castings. These castings contain valuable plant nutrients in forms that are easily absorbed by roots.

The finished vermicompost is odorless, crumbly, and rich in organic matter. It acts as both a fertilizer and a soil conditioner, making it one of the most versatile products for gardening and agriculture.

Nutritional Value of Vermicompost

One of the primary reasons for the popularity of vermicompost is its impressive nutrient profile. It contains:

  • Nitrogen (N) for healthy leaf growth
  • Phosphorus (P) for strong root development
  • Potassium (K) for flowering and fruit production
  • Calcium and Magnesium for overall plant health
  • Iron, Zinc, Copper, and other micronutrients
  • Beneficial microorganisms that improve soil biology

These nutrients are released gradually, ensuring plants receive continuous nourishment over an extended period.

Benefits of Organic Vermicompost

1. Improves Soil Structure

Vermicompost increases soil porosity and aeration, allowing roots to grow deeper and stronger. It helps the soil retain moisture while ensuring proper drainage, creating the perfect environment for plant development.

2. Rich Source of Essential Nutrients

It provides plants with important nutrients such as nitrogen, phosphorus, potassium, calcium, magnesium, and micronutrients in a readily available form. This balanced nutrition supports vigorous growth and higher yields.

3. Encourages Healthy Root Development

The natural compounds present in vermicompost stimulate root growth, helping plants absorb nutrients and water more efficiently.

4. Enhances Plant Immunity

Plants grown with vermicompost often show greater resistance to pests, diseases, and environmental stress. Healthy soil leads to healthier plants.

5. Environmentally Friendly

Organic vermicompost is produced from biodegradable waste materials, reducing landfill waste and promoting sustainable agriculture. It is completely natural and safe for humans, pets, and the environment.
